THE ULTIMATE GUIDE TO C# OBJECT KULLANıMı

The Ultimate Guide To C# Object Kullanımı

The Ultimate Guide To C# Object Kullanımı

Blog Article



Sınıflar soyut olarak bildirilebilir; başka bir deyişle bir veya elan ziyade yöntemin uygulaması yoktur. Soyut sınıfların örneği elden oluşturulamasa da, sakim uygulamayı sağlayıcı öteki sınıflar bağırsakin bel kemiği sınıflar olarak vazife yapabilir.

C# yürekindeki bir klas sadece bir baz sınıftan doğrudan devralabilir. Fakat, bir bel kemiği dershaneın kendisi başka bir sınıftan devralabileceğinden, bir klas dolaylı olarak takkadak çok asliye sınıfı devralabilir.

C# dilinde Object sınıfı, farklı veri mimarilarının oluşturulmasında ve yönetilmesinde kullanılır. Örneğin, ArrayList kadar devimsel dizi film bünyelarında Object dershaneı çoğunlukla kullanılır.

object ahmet1 = "ahmet";//Boxing string ahmet2 = (string)ahmet1;//Unboxing Son olarak object tipli değalışverişkenler de,değmeslekkenin zarfında ki verinin tipini canlı olarak öğrenmek istiyorsak dundaki metod anlayışimizi görecektir.

Object klası, C# dilindeki en ana sınıftır ve biraşkın ana maslahatlevi bağırsakerir. Bu fiillevler arasında nesne oluşturma, denklik muhaliflaştırması yapma, hash kodu transfer gibi ustalıklemler bulunur.

O hengâm object klasından aracısız ürettiğimiz nesneler istediğimiz her şekle geliyorsa ne o kadar çok değişici türü seçmek ile uğraşıyoruz? Bu probleminin yanıtı derunin bile üstteki koda bir satırlık olağan bir iş ekleyelim.

Bu hatmızda var ve object değustalıkkenlerinin kullanma ve dokumasından bahsedeceğiz.Sair değnöbetkenlerle arasındaki farktan ziyade bu dü parametre arasındaki farkı anlamak elan önemli.

Kullanıcıların TextBox'a makbul veriler girmesini çıkarmak için data doğrulama kuralları uygulayabilirsiniz. Örneğin, yalnızca dijital girişleri akseptans eden bir TextBox oluşturabilirsiniz.

Fevkdaki örnekte “var” bileğmeslekkeni field’i söz gelişi eder. O yüzden C#’ta Prop ile Property kavramlarını karıştırmamak geçişsiz. Property aksiyonlemlerini bir field üzeriden yaparken, Prop’te bir field tanımlamaya lazım yoktur.

Oluşturucu eder kucakin monthlyDeposit varsayılan bir kadir sağlar, sonunda arayanlar maaş tıkır yatırma mesleklemi strüktürlmadan atlayabilir 0 .

Sırf hedeflenen istemci kodunun ulaşabilmesi kucakin kodunuzun erişilebilirliğini sınırlamak önemlidir. Bayağıdaki muvasala değnöbettiricilerini kullanarak türlerinizin ve üyelerinizin istemci koduna C# Object Kullanımı ne denli erişilebilir olduğunu belirtirsiniz:

TextBox'a yalnızca makul bir uzunlukta dayanıklı girişi yapılmasını katkısızlayabilirsiniz. Bu, dayanıklı sınırlamaları olan alanlar için kullanışlıdır.

TextAlign                  :Texbox'daki edebiyatın sağ'dan yahut sol'dan makaslamaklmasını ayarlar.

Şimdi projeme bir klasör ekliyorum ve yerine Interface makaleversiyon. Klasör üzerinde sağ tık yapmış olup Add diyerek bir New Item diyorum ve bir Interface ekliyorum.

Report this page